Kinases and phosphatases
Kinases are one of the largest enzyme families in the human genome. Knowing that putative kinase sequences constitute at least 2% of the human genome and that around 30% of all proteins contain covalently bound phosphate, phosphorylation appears as a key process in signal transduction.
